    Irving "Sully" Boyar (December 14, 1923 – March 23, 2001) was an American actor of Russian-Jewish descent. Boyar was one of seven children, some of whom grew up to become lawyers and businessmen. He also worked as a lawyer before turning to acting.

  3. Apr 14, 2001 · Sully Boyar, a character actor who worked in films, on television and in theater, died on March 23 while waiting for a bus in Whitestone, Queens, where he lived. He was 77.

  6. Mar 23, 2001 · Sully Boyar. Actor. He gained fame as a stage and film actor who often had character or supporting roles. Born Israel Sully Boyar, a twin in a large Russian-Jewish family, he studied law, becoming a lawyer before entering an acting career. On Broadway in 1977, he appeared in The Basic Training of Pavlo Hummel.
